What Is a Lien Release From Toyota Motor Credit Corp?
While you are paying off your car loan, both you and your finance company will appear on your car title. Once you have paid off your car loan, Toyota Motor Credit Corp will need to so that you can get a clear title in your name. The lien release tells the department of motor vehicles that you have met your debt obligation fully, and that the car now belongs to you.
Toyota Motor Credit Corp normally sends out lien release forms several days after receiving the final payment on your car loan. There are occasionally delays that you don't expect.
If you haven't paid off your car yet, but you want to sell it sooner, you will need to get a lien release from Toyota Motor Corp before that sale can be finalized. While title liens on vehicles and other property are standard and do not show up as a negative on your credit report, getting that loan paid off will show up as an auto loan successfully paid on your credit report and actually might even bring your credit score up a few points.
What Does a Notice of Transfer and Release of Liability Do?
The Notice of Transfer and Release of Liability is the main document you will need to take to the DMV. A notice of transfer and release of liability, when it comes from the finance company, will allow you to either register the title in your name or it will let you sell the vehicle to someone else.
When you use it to sell your car, it means that from the moment you sell the car to someone else, the liability for that vehicle is now on them. That you can no longer be held liable for anything that happens to the vehicle.
How to Request a Lien Release From Toyota Motor Credit Corp
When you have paid off your loan, the Toyota Motor Credit Corp will normally send you the or a new title within a few days. If you don't receive this documentation, you will have to request a lien release from the company.
- Go to the Toyota Financial website.
- Enter your username and password
- Access your account information.
- Select Payoff information
- Verify that the site shows your loan is paid off
- Click on request lien release.

How Long Does It Take to Get a Lien Release From Toyota Motor Credit Corp?
When you have made your final payment to Toyota Motor Credit Corp, it will take approximately three days to process your lean release. Most people receive their lien release or title that has been signed over to you and that accompanies a lien release letter, 10 days after the final payment has been processed by Toyota.
